1. Verizon offers discounts for nurses and their families

Verizon offers discounts for nurses and their families to show appreciation for their hard work. Nurses can save up to $160 per month on their plan with the Verizon Nurse Discount (Nurses Unlimited). This discount is available for both Verizon Wireless and Verizon Fios. How much you can save depends on how many lines you have. The discount for a single line is $10 a month. For 2-3 lines, it’s $25 a month per phone, while for 4+ lines, it’s $20 per month per line, and these savings apply to your entire account. Only nurses and respiratory therapists are eligible for this discount, and they need to be currently working. Retired nurses or nurses in training are not eligible.

To get the Verizon nursing discount, nurses should confirm their eligibility using the id.me tool and finish making changes to their Verizon plan. You can either do this online, which may take a few billing cycles for the plan to take effect, or by calling Verizon directly. Nurses must be account owners or account managers and need to revalidate their employment annually by having an active National Provider Identifier number. Auto Pay and paper-free billing are required to get the discount. Verizon is also offering a discount for nurses who have Verizon Fios, with savings ranging from $5 to $15 off per month, depending on the plan. Existing and new customers are eligible for this discount, and the eligibility requirements and sign-up process are the same as for Verizon Wireless nursing promotions. With these easy-to-follow steps, nurses and their families can take advantage of these discounts and save on their Verizon bills. [1][2]

9. Verizon Fios also offers discounts for nurses

Verizon Fios also offers discounts for nurses. As a nurse, you can get a monthly discount on Fios Home Internet service. Here's how to get started:

First, check if Fios Home Internet is available in your area. It's currently available in key metro areas in New Jersey, New York, Maryland, Delaware, Massachusetts, Pennsylvania, Rhode Island, Virginia, and in Washington DC.

Next, make sure you're eligible for the discount. To qualify, you must be a currently-employed nurse (LPN, LVN, NP, or RN) or a currently-employed respiratory therapist with a valid National Provider Identifier (NPI) number.

Once you've confirmed eligibility, validate your employment as part of the discount registration. You can get a discount with any one of these plans: $15 off/month on Gigabit Connection. Note that this discount cannot be combined with any other promotion or the Ultimate Employee offer. The limit is one military, first responder, teacher, or nurse discount per account.

If you're already a Verizon customer with an eligible plan, you can change to an eligible available plan to get the discount. And if you're a new Fios customer, the $99 setup fee is waived when you complete your qualifying order.

10. Confirm eligibility using id.me and wait 1-2 billing cycles for changes to take effect.

If you're a nurse or respiratory therapist, you may be eligible for a discount on your Verizon plan. Here's how to confirm your eligibility using id.me and get the discount applied to your account.

The first step is to confirm your eligibility using id.me. Create an account and link your certifications, if they aren't showing up already. Once you've done this, make the necessary changes to your Verizon plan. Note that Verizon's website is old, so your discount won't show up in your shopping cart when you make the changes online. Instead, Verizon will generally send you an email confirmation that the discount has been applied to your account.

After confirming your eligibility using id.me, you'll need to wait 1-2 billing cycles for the plan changes to take effect. Alternatively, you can call Verizon to get the discount applied to your plan. Although this method may take a bit longer, it can be helpful if something goes wrong during the process; Verizon may offer courtesy one-time credits if they've made an error.

Remember that this discount is only available to nurses and respiratory therapists who are currently working in their field. To be eligible, you must also be an account owner or account manager, and the discount only applies to postpaid, not pre-paid plans.
